Full Description: This impressive 1920's detached family home, built by the highly regarded Streather Homes, is located in one of Sutton Coldfield's most sought after residential areas. The house has been thoughtfully maintained and updated, blending the charm of its original period features with the comfort and convenience expected in a modern home. Offering a wealth of versatile living space across two floors, it is perfectly suited for family life, entertaining, and working from home.
The Fore Set back from the road, the property enjoys an attractive frontage with a neatly maintained lawn and mature planting that provide both privacy and kerb appeal. A driveway offers ample off road parking and leads to an integral garage, giving both practicality and secure storage. The traditional frontage, with its bay windows and distinctive architecture, is typical of Streather Homes and instantly conveys a sense of character and quality. A covered entrance porch welcomes you into the home, setting the tone for the spacious accommodation within.
Ground Floor On entering the house, you are greeted by a bright and generous hallway which provides access to the principal reception rooms and sets an inviting first impression. To the front of the property, the formal dining room with its bay window creates a wonderful setting for family meals and entertaining guests, benefitting from both natural light and views of the front garden. The lounge is positioned to the rear and is an impressive living space, with large windows and garden views that flood the room with light and provide a calming outlook.
At the heart of the home is the spacious kitchen diner, designed to suit the needs of modern family life. This open and versatile area offers ample space for cooking, dining and socialising, making it the true hub of the household. The kitchen diner flows naturally into a family room, creating a highly practical layout that allows children to play, homework to be supervised, or guests to relax while meals are being prepared. A separate utility room provides additional storage and space for appliances, helping to keep the kitchen clutter free, while a convenient ground floor WC adds further practicality. The ground floor is completed by internal access to the garage, which could also be adapted for other uses if required.
First Floor The staircase rises to a spacious landing which connects the five well proportioned bedrooms. The principal bedroom is positioned to the rear of the house and benefits from its own en suite shower room, offering a private retreat for parents. The remaining bedrooms are each generously sized and filled with natural light, providing comfortable accommodation for children, guests or extended family. Bedroom 5, currently used as a study, offers excellent flexibility for modern living. Whether required as a dedicated home office, a nursery, a hobby room, or simply as an additional bedroom, it underlines the adaptable nature of the layout. A family bathroom and a separate WC serve the remaining bedrooms, ensuring there is no shortage of facilities upstairs.
The Rear To the rear, the property opens out onto a beautifully maintained garden that provides a private and peaceful setting. With a combination of lawn, mature borders and seating areas, the garden offers plenty of space for outdoor dining, children's play and family gatherings. It is a garden that can be enjoyed throughout the year, offering both practicality and tranquillity, and complementing the spacious living accommodation inside the house.
